Rookie RB missed 2024 season (second ACL injury Dec 2024, week 14) after being drafted in round 2 by Panthers. Community deeply divided: bullish case argues he's a first-round talent at 8th-round ADP, Dave Canales pick, team's lack of offseason RB moves signals confidence, and comparable to Jeanty/Love prospect level; bearish case emphasizes he's effectively a rookie with zero NFL production, two knee injuries, and Hubbard is proven 1000-yard back. Some cite Christian Watson ACL recovery (9 months) as precedent; others argue Watson had prior NFL success. Consensus: high-risk, high-reward swing; health is primary obstacle, not Hubbard.
